TechINT Solutions Group is looking for a Data Analyst to work onsite in Reston, VA, or fully remote supporting DHS's Continuous Diagnostic & Mitigation (CDM) Program.
Job# TI1031 This CDM role requires developing analysis and reporting of Data, including identifying data gaps.
The successful candidate will bring a consultative approach to data analysis in solving our clients' cyber security problems, coupled with demonstrated experience designing and developing enterprise data solutions for Federal government clients.
This is not a database administrator role, but a hands-on Data Analyst position.
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
:
Review, Identify, Analyze data from multiple source Cyber Security tools at multiple agencies.
Interpret data, analyze results using statistical techniques and provide ongoing reports based on the customer needs.
Develop and implement databases, data collection systems, data analytics and other strategies that optimize statistical efficiency and quality Acquire data from primary and other data sources and maintain databases/data systems Run ad-hoc reports from source systems and work with Tool SMEs, integration developers in identifying data defects.
Identify, analyze, and interpret trends or patterns in complex data sets Analyze source data and types, identify data requirements for destination systems.
Analyze, interpret, and report on data based on Data Dictionary & Logical Data Models guidance.
Work with Agency and Agency representatives in resolving data quality, completeness, and accuracy issues.
Locate and define new process improvement opportunities Ensure mapping of data elements provided by COTS products to the Logical Data Model Other duties as assigned Requirements:
Minimum of 5 years of experience in Data Analytic work for mission critical systems within Fed/CIV, DOD, or Intel Minimum of 5 years of experience performing or assisting in the analysis of enterprise IT logs, data, and/or information preferably in Security Operations Experience collaborating with Federal clients to mature operational processes, reduce redundancies, and develop innovative solutions Experience understanding organizational needs, proposing solutions, and managing project execution efforts designed to deliver overall program benefits for Government Agencies Experience collaborating with US Government Agencies, state or local governments, or commercial entities to develop IT service program maturity in accordance with Federal IT mandates and best practices Experience in conducting assessments of an Enterprise by reviewing technical documentation, conducting interviews and workshops to identify gaps and develop a tailored solution is highly desired Demonstrated experience in security solution design using existing as well as emerging technologies to deliver enterprise solutions BS in Mathematics, Economics, Computer Science, Information Management or Statistics Proven working experience with large Data set from multiple systems including machine data, cyber security tool data and other relevant data that is used within an enterprise for security posture.
Proficient at querying data in MS/Azure SQL server and Elasticsearch/Kibana for data issues, gaps, and trend Writing reports and presenting findings Technical expertise regarding data models, database design development, data mining and segmentation techniques Strong knowledge of and experience with reporting packages (Business Objects etc), databases (SQL, MySql etc.
), programming (XML, Javascript, or ETL frameworks) Knowledge of statistics and experience using statistical packages for analyzing datasets (Excel, SPSS, SAS etc) Experience in translating derived requirements by analyzing Logical Data Models and Data Dictionary to provide data mapping from source systems.
Strong analytical skills with the ability to collect, organize, analyze, and disseminate significant amounts of information with attention to detail and accuracy Experience with collaborating with other roles, such as solution architects, data engineers, data scientists, AI engineers, database administrators, and developers.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
